Required Vaccines:
To keep our pack healthy and happy:
Rabies
DHPP (Distemper, Hepatitis, Parvo, Parainfluenza)
Bordetella (Kennel Cough)
Recommended Vaccines:
Because prevention is better than surprise vet bills:
Leptospirosis
Canine Influenza
Lyme Disease

Kennel Cough Prevention:
We take kennel cough seriously, but just like kids catching colds at school, it’s a common canine “cold” that’s hard to avoid 100%. That’s why we pull out all the stops: veterinarian-approved sanitation products, temperature and humidity monitoring, pest control, and filtered water. Our goal? Keep your pup healthy and sniffle-free as much as possible — because sniffles belong in tissues, not doggy daycare!
